Why Local Citations and Consistency Matter So Much

One strategy I swear by is ensuring consistent NAP (Name, Address, Phone Number) information across all listings. I learned that search engines value accuracy and consistency, which helps build trust and authority. For example, I regularly audit my citations to make sure they align perfectly with my GMB profile. This approach has consistently boosted my local rankings and enhanced my business visibility in Chandler.

Unlocking the Hidden Layers of Local SEO: Beyond Basic Strategies

While foundational tactics like NAP consistency and reviews are essential, seasoned SEO professionals know that diving deeper into schema markup and local link building can dramatically elevate your Chandler business’s visibility. Implementing structured data on your website helps search engines better understand your content, reinforcing your local relevance. For instance, adding schema for your business type, operating hours, and geographic coordinates can give Google additional signals to rank you higher in local packs. How Can Strategic Local Partnerships Amplify Your Maps Rankings?

Forming alliances with other local businesses creates valuable backlink opportunities and boosts your authority in the eyes of Google. For example, collaborating with Chandler-area suppliers or community organizations can lead to mentions and backlinks from reputable sources. These not only improve your SEO but also foster genuine community engagement, which Google values highly. Participating in local events and sponsoring community initiatives can be powerful ways to earn backlinks naturally. According to Moz’s local search ranking factors, local link signals are a significant factor in map pack positioning.

Are You Overlooking the Power of Voice Search in Local SEO?

With the rise of voice-activated devices, optimizing for voice search has become a vital component of local SEO. Voice queries tend to be more conversational and question-focused. For Chandler businesses, this means tailoring your content to answer common questions like “Where can I find the best pizza in Chandler?” or “What are the top-rated hair salons near me?” Incorporating FAQ sections with natural language and long-tail keywords can help capture these voice searches. According to Search Engine Land, optimizing for voice search can give you a competitive edge, especially in localized markets.

Harnessing Schema Markup to Elevate Your Local Listings

Implementing structured data through schema markup has been a game-changer in my approach to local SEO. Beyond basic business details, I’ve experimented with adding schema for specific services, customer reviews, and even event promotions within Chandler. This rich data not only enhances the appearance of my local listings but also improves Google’s understanding of my offerings, leading to higher rankings in local packs. For instance, adding schema for my service hours and geographic coordinates helped clarify my business’s operational scope, resulting in better visibility during relevant searches. To master this, I recommend studying detailed schema implementation guides and testing your structured data using tools like Google’s Rich Results Test.
